Global Public Investor Working Group report launch

Live: Wednesday 26 November 13:00 (London)

Following a series of depth interviews with leading central banks, OMFIF’s global investor working group sheds light on how central banks are navigating a challenging global macroeconomic and geopolitical environment. The insights gleaned from these discussions and from a recent event during the IMF/WBG annual meetings as well as the findings from OMFIF’s GPI 2025 culminates in a report covering geopolitical risks, evolving reserve management strategies, operating models and the role of external managers, asset allocation decisions and currency diversification.

About the Economic and Monetary Policy Institute

IMG_8806

OMFIF’s Economic and Monetary Policy Institute is a trusted forum that convenes a global community of central banks, finance ministries, regulators, banks, investors, consultants and other organisations to explore the future of the global economy.

The bedrock of EMP is our off-the-record roundtables with key policy-makers across the world, allowing members to actively discuss the factors the factors shaping economic policy and market trends. In 2024, we hosted over 30 in-person membership events across the UK, Germany and the US as well as more
than 20 virtually, with over 1,000 members across the public and private sector
registering to attend.

Moreover, through our market-leading Global Public Investor series, we have engaged with 160 central banks, public pension funds and sovereign funds across the world to explore their main investment strategies. We aim to deepen our engagement in 2025 through a new working group on reserve management diversification strategies.
